LTC3672B-1
Monolithic Fixed-Output
400mA Buck Regulator with Dual
150mA LDOs in 2mm × 2mm DFN
FEATURES
■ Triple Output Supply From a Single 2.9V to 5.5V Input
■ Buck DC/DC: Fixed 1.8V Output, Up to 400mA
■ LDO1: Fixed 1.2V Output, Up to 150mA
■ LDO2: Fixed 2.8V Output, Up to 150mA
■ ±2.5% Reference Accuracy
■ Constant Frequency 2.25MHz Operation
■ Minimum External Component Count
■ Current Mode Operation for Excellent Line and Load
Transient Response
■ Internal Soft-Start for Each Output
■ Single Enable Pin Turns On/Shuts Down All Three
Outputs
■ Tiny 2mm × 2mm × 0.75mm DFN Package
APPLICATIONS
■ DMB Cellphones
■ Handheld Products (PDA, PMP, GPS)
■ Multivoltage Power for Digital Logic, I/O, FPGAs,
CPLDs, ASICs, CPUs, and RF Chipsets
DESCRIPTION
The LTC®3672B-1 is a triple power supply composed of a
400mA synchronous buck regulator and two 150mA low-
dropout linear regulators (LDOs), where one of the LDOs
can be powered from the buck output to improve efficiency.
Constant-frequency 2.25MHz operation is maintained
down to very light loads. The input supply range of 2.9V
to 5.5V is especially well-suited for single-cell Lithium-Ion
and Lithium-Polymer applications, and for powering low
voltage ASICs from 3.3V or 5V rails.
The LTC3672B-1 regulates 1.8V at the buck output, 1.2V
at the LDO1 output, and 2.8V at the LDO2 output. Exter-
nal component count is minimal—all that is needed is a
single inductor, an input capacitor, and output capacitors
for each of the three outputs. Control loop compensation
is internal to the LTC3672B-1.
The LTC3672B-1 is available in a 2mm × 2mm × 0.75mm
8-Lead DFN package.
